I brought with me my poolside essentials knowing we were going to be spending quite a bit of time by the water.
1. Sun Protection
With all that time outside, we all made sure to apply (and reapply) lots of waterproof sunscreen. No sunburns! We also wore protective sunglasses and a hat for when we were out of the pool, but still spending time outside.
2. A Pedicure
Brightly painted toes are so cute poolside!
3. Reading Material
It’s nice to have something to enjoy when you are not in the pool. I brought some magazines and my Kindle. Magazine are nice just in case they get wet-it’s not like you ruined anything expensive!
